In the 1970s and 1980s, feminist theologians offered some necessary and powerful critiques of both the patriarchal nature of the Bible and of historical Christianity, especially of the Roman Catholic Church. While grappling with the tradition, each needed to determine whether to "retrieve" the tradition (e.g., Elisabeth Schussler-Fiorenza) or to move "beyond" it (e.g., Mary Daly).
Gebara, although a member of a Catholic religious community in Brazil, clearly places herself in the latter category. Sadly, she does this not with a clear and strong critique, but with a weak form of pantheism that flows out of the "new universe" movement of people like Thomas Berry and Brian Schwimme. Sad, because both the ancient Israelites and Jesus of Nazareth had great reverence for Creation, but expressed it by recognizing the Presence and power of the Creator, intimately available as Father/Mother. Gebara would substitute "the Sacred Body" of earth and proclaim "we must save one another."
If you are interested in New Age self-help, you might enjoy this book.
